Re[2]: Рисование больших картинок в BCB 6.0
От: de cobre Россия  
Дата: 15.12.06 15:41
Оценка:
Здравствуйте, Danchik, Вы писали:

D>Уточните детали.

D>Вы рисуете на дескрипторе экрана картинку (Bitmap 8000x8000).
Я видимо криво объяснил.
В данном случае рисование происходит на Panel->Canvas. Но это совершенно не принципиально, т.к. например если использовать TBitmap объект, то при задание такого же размера вылетает точно такой же трабл.
D>И у вас при вызове Canvas.Draw(X, Y, Bitmap) вылетает ошибка.
Например при: Panel->Canvas->Pen->Color = clBlack;
В общем, совершенно не принципиально какой метод будет вызван после Panel->Canvas->* сразу вылетает ошибка. Видимо инициализация битовой матрицы происходит не сразу а при вызове любого из методов холста, с этим и связано появление ошибки.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.